Kilkerran is the brand name under which the single malt whisky from the Glengyle Distillery in Campbeltown is released. When we talk about the Glengyle Distillery, this is the distillery that was built at the beginning of this century in and on the remains of an earlier Glengyle Distillery that was closed in 1925.The brand name Kilkerran was chosen because the name Glengyle was already used for a Highland blended malt and the right to the name belongs to Loch Lomond. Kilkerran is the name of the vault in which one Sint Kerran lived, where Campbeltown is now located.
This 12-year-old Kilkerran single malt whisky is a standard bottling from the Glengyle Distillery. The whisky matured in bourbon and sherry casks. If you want an affordable whisky with maritime, fruity and sweet notes, then this is an option! (46% ABV)
Campbeltown distillery Glengyle started in 2004 with the production of Kilkerran single malt whisky. In that same year, this batch was casked. A Fino sherry puncheon to be precise. In September 2019 it was bottled at cask strength (51.6%).
In 2004, the Glengyle Distillery reopened after a renovation. In that year, the spirit for this Kilkerran single malt flowed from the new stills and was aged for 15 years, first in a first-fill oloroso cask and then for five years in a bourbon cask. 52.6%
To celebrate its 15th anniversary, Glengyle Distillery released this Kilkerran Single Cask edition. The 15-year-old Campbeltown single malt whisky matured for the first ten years in a Fino sherry cask and then in a bourbon hogshead. (52.1% ABV)
This is a Kilkerran single-cask bottling in honour of the 15th anniversary of the (re)opening of Campbeltown distillery Glengyle (2004). The creamy single malt whisky matured for those 15 years in a rum cask and is bottled at a cask strength of 53.2%.
A 2017 bottling from Campbeltown distillery Glengyle, this 8-year-old Kilkerran single malt whisky was released in the Cask Strength series. The whisky matured in bourbon casks and was bottled at, yes, a cask strength of 56.2% ABV.
Campbeltown distillery Glengyle released the 14th batch in the Heavily Peated-Small Batch series of its Kilkerran single malt whisky. The peated dram matured in both bourbon and sherry casks. The hefty 58.3% alcohol is nicely integrated.
